Wang Yifu's father Yi was the General of Pingbei. When he had official business, he sent messengers to discuss it, but they could not. At that time, Yi Fu was in the capital, and he ordered his carriage to meet with the Minister of State Yang Hu and the Minister of State Shan Tao. Yi Fu was a child at the time. He was handsome and talented. He could narrate things quickly and his stories were logical. Tao was very impressed by him. After he left, he continued to watch and sighed, "Shouldn't the son he had be like Wang Yifu?" Yang Hu said, "The one who will cause chaos in the world will be this child!"

The two sons of Yang Huai, the governor of Jizhou, Qiao and Mao, were both born with the intention of becoming talented people. Huai was friendly with Pei Wei and Yue Guang, so he sent people to meet them. Huai was generous and open-minded. He loved Qiao's high rhyme and said to Huai, "Qiao is as good as you, but Mao is a little inferior." Guang was pure and honest. He loved Mao's prudent mind and said to Huai, "Qiao is as good as you, but Mao is even more outstanding." Huai laughed and said, "The superiority and inferiority of my two sons is the superiority and inferiority of Pei and Le." Commentators commented that although Qiao had high rhyme, he was not prudent enough; while Le's words were appropriate. However, they are both outstanding talents that came later.
